'Item' is corrupted or isn't a Microsoft Access database.

Error 3049

Possible causes:

          You tried to open a Btrieve, dBASE, or Paradox database or table.  Instead, attach the database or table to an existing Visual Basic database.

          You tried to import or attach a Paradox database or table, and the associated .PX file couldn't be found.  Check to make sure the .PX file is in the same directory as the Paradox database or table, and then try the operation again.

          If the specified database is a Visual Basic database, that database has become corrupted.  You should attempt to repair the database.  If the database can't be repaired, restore the database from a backup copy; or create a new database.
